Fireman’s Park, located at 673 Penfield St, Beecher, IL, is a welcoming dog park in Beecher, Illinois, perfect for pet owners looking for a safe and accessible outdoor space. This park is fully wheelchair accessible, featuring both an accessible entrance and parking lot, making it inclusive for all visitors. It offers a variety of amenities that cater to families and dog lovers alike, including a baseball field, picnic tables, public restrooms, slides, swings, and a playground, ensuring a fun day out for everyone.
